Northwest Pipe Company Rebrands as NWPX Infrastructure

VANCOUVER, Wash., June 12, 2025 — Northwest Pipe Company, a prominent player in the construction and engineering sector, has announced a significant rebranding initiative. The company, known for its expertise in manufacturing welded steel pipes for water transmission and other applications, will now operate under the name NWPX Infrastructure, Inc. This change reflects the company’s evolution and its commitment to growth, innovation, and a future-focused vision.

The rebranding marks a pivotal moment in the company’s history, symbolizing its transformation into a modern, solutions-driven infrastructure provider with a national footprint. Despite the name change, the company will retain its long-standing Nasdaq ticker symbol, NWPX, honoring its legacy of quality, integrity, and performance.

Scott Montross, President and Chief Executive Officer of NWPX Infrastructure, emphasized that the transition is more than just a name change. “It reflects who we are today—a forward-looking company addressing the nation’s most critical water infrastructure challenges,” Montross stated. “We’re positioning ourselves for long-term growth while remaining grounded in the values that have guided Northwest Pipe for more than five decades.”

The new corporate identity underscores the company’s expanded capabilities in precast and engineered systems, along with a broader, more diversified product offering. This strategic move aims to better align the company’s brand with its enhanced service portfolio and its role in addressing critical infrastructure needs across the United States.

As of June 10, 2025, NWPX Infrastructure’s stock closed at $39.51 on the Nasdaq, with a market capitalization of approximately $389.79 million. The company’s financial fundamentals, including a price-to-earnings ratio of 12.04, reflect its stable position within the industrials sector. Over the past year, the stock has experienced fluctuations, reaching a 52-week high of $57.76 on December 5, 2024, and a low of $32.04 on June 20, 2024.
